An attractive character semi-detached property set over 3 floors with potential to extend (subject to the necessary consents), a good size garden, off road parking, outbuilding/workshop and shed. Situated on the outskirts of this popular village and within easy reach of both the historic town of Tenterden and Ashford, and its international station with fast train to London St Pancras only 37 minutes.

1 Summerhill Cottages is conveniently located in the village of High Halden with its local village store providing day-to-day needs, church and popular pub. It lies between the historic Tenterden town centre 2.5 miles to the south, with its picturesque high street and shops and the market town of Ashford approximately 10 miles away providing M20 motorway connections, an international railway station offering Eurostar services and High Speed commuting to London St. Pancras from 37 minutes. The railway stations at Pluckley and Headcorn are within a few miles drive.

1 Summerhill Cottages
1 Summerhill Cottages is a character semi detached property built in 1868. Originally a tied cottage and extended in the 1960’s with a double storey rear extension for the kitchen with bathroom above.
Today the property offers scope for someone to put their own mark on it and offers the following accommodation:

On the ground floor there is an open plan kitchen/dining room with stairs to the first floor. Beyond here is the cosy sitting room with feature fireplace and wood burning stove with shelves and cupboard either side.
On the first floor there is a double bedroom, a single bedroom and the family bathroom with bath and shower over, w/c and vanity wash basin. There are stairs leading up to the attic room which has been used as a bedroom and has eaves storage either side. There are also some lovely views over the surrounding countryside from the rear windows.

The property has a driveway with off-road parking for several vehicles to the front and mature hedging. There is a side gate into the rear garden which has a patio, shed, greenhouse and outbuilding/workshop. The majority of the garden is laid to lawn with mature shrubs, trees and plants. Planting, includes two well established grape vines, fruit bushes, an old apple tree, an old quince tree and two damson trees. There is also an enclosed/raised vegetable bed and an old well. The garden adjoins fields which sometimes has cows grazing. There is also a neighbours pond to one corner (fenced) which attracts some wonderful wildlife.
